Transaction 64302b8b1497dcbe11688705a028927e8c5d363a46eaf93b2d2aec2d9e920e02

34 Input
2 Outputs
  • 64302b8b1497dcbe11688705a028927e8c5d363a46eaf93b2d2aec2d9e920e02:0
  • value  599912122
    address  15Fi79rqCuuthxrhMiU8DMd6KKriSPudNf
  • 64302b8b1497dcbe11688705a028927e8c5d363a46eaf93b2d2aec2d9e920e02:1
  • value  1000009
    address  1DaZ9Nj4MGPKvsYUx9Hsq5vSXw2rQWC6pE